From: "karlp at tweak dot net.au" <sourceware-bugzilla@sourceware.org> To: glibc-bugs@sourceware.org Subject: [Bug time/29774] New: tzselect: doesn't handle new backlinks, places some countries in the wrong regions Date: Thu, 10 Nov 2022 16:35:33 +0000 [thread overview] Message-ID: <bug-29774-131@http.sourceware.org/bugzilla/> (raw) https://sourceware.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=29774 Bug ID: 29774 Summary: tzselect: doesn't handle new backlinks, places some countries in the wrong regions Product: glibc Version: 2.36 Status: UNCONFIRMED Severity: normal Priority: P2 Component: time Assignee: unassigned at sourceware dot org Reporter: karlp at tweak dot net.au Target Milestone: --- With the changes in tz for backzones and backlinks, at least starting from here: https://github.com/eggert/tz/commit/0b925f6d8aaf927ac20049ae0ff3b527684b60c7 with tzdb-2022c, the version of tzselect in glibc no longer places countries like Iceland in "Atlantic" but in "Africa" This is fixed and works correctly using tzselect from the tzdb itself, likely via https://github.com/eggert/tz/commit/e5f99199ff4efe0808a5076c2484d5b86193124d glibc's tzselect hasn't been touched since it was synced with upstream to 2018g ( see https://sourceware.org/git/?p=glibc.git;a=history;f=timezone/tzselect.ksh) I propose that glibc update tzselect again from upstream. (This will likely also fix https://sourceware.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=28227) Example using system tzselect (glibc) (no iceland) ``` karlp@strem:~/src/junk/tz.git ((2022e))$ /usr/bin/tzselect Please identify a location so that time zone rules can be set correctly. Please select a continent, ocean, "coord", or "TZ". 1) Africa 7) Europe 2) Americas 8) Indian Ocean 3) Antarctica 9) Pacific Ocean 4) Asia 10) coord - I want to use geographical coordinates. 5) Atlantic Ocean 11) TZ - I want to specify the timezone using the Posix TZ format. 6) Australia #? 5 Please select a country whose clocks agree with yours. 1) Bermuda 4) Faroe Islands 7) Spain 2) Cape Verde 5) Portugal 3) Falkland Islands 6) South Georgia & the South Sandwich Islands #? ``` Example using upstream tzselect ``` karlp@strem:~/src/junk/tz.git ((2022e))$ ./tzselect Please identify a location so that time zone rules can be set correctly. Please select a continent, ocean, "coord", or "TZ". 1) Africa 7) Australia 2) Americas 8) Europe 3) Antarctica 9) Indian Ocean 4) Arctic Ocean 10) Pacific Ocean 5) Asia 11) coord - I want to use geographical coordinates. 6) Atlantic Ocean 12) TZ - I want to specify the timezone using the Posix TZ format. #? 6 Please select a country whose clocks agree with yours. 1) Bermuda 4) Faroe Islands 7) South Georgia & the South Sandwich Islands 2) Cape Verde 5) Iceland 8) Spain 3) Falkland Islands 6) Portugal 9) St Helena #? ``` -- You are receiving this mail because: You are on the CC list for the bug.
